Guys, i Just want to know the Best Odi/test matches u seen. I know people has seen a lot of classic, but u can share some on the forum.
For me
ODI-South Africa vs Australia at Johannesburg. The best ODI ever. Australia batted first and set the world record of 434-4 after 50 overs. South Africa showed bags of resilience to come back and win the match and setting a new record of 438-9.I know it everybody of us like this match.What a finish from SA.
Test-England vs Australia at Edgbaston. The greatest test ever. England set a good score of 408 in their first innings. Australia turned it around and looked like winning when Geraint Jones took a brilliant catch to dismiss Michael Kasprowicz.One stage i thought that match ended in drew but they done it and won the match by 2 runs.  |

I think that the match was not won by the aussies but it was lost by the SA. Still remeber the silly mistake made by Klusenor and Donald. There were 3 balls left and no need to hurry for the single. Donald was spared in the last delivery from a close run out but again he went for it.
What can we say. It has been pure bad luck with South Africa in the World cups since 1992. |
